Как добавить строку, столбец или ячейки в таблицу Excel
Чтобы вставить новую строку или столбец в Excel, выделите соседнюю строку (кликнув по её номеру) или столбец (по букве), нажмите правую кнопку мыши и выберите «Вставить». Самый быстрый способ — выделить область и нажать комбинацию Ctrl + Shift + «+» (плюс на цифровой клавиатуре или обычный). Новые элементы всегда появляются перед выделенной областью: строка — выше, столбец — левее.
Эта операция необходима при расширении отчетов, добавлении новых позиций в прайс-лист или исправлении структуры данных. Ниже рассмотрены все методы: от базовых действий мышью до работы с защищенными листами и умными таблицами.
Вставка строк: основные методы
Строки в Excel нумеруются слева. При вставке новой строки все данные ниже сдвигаются вниз, а формулы автоматически обновляются.
Способ 1: Контекстное меню (классический)
Самый наглядный метод для новичков:
- Наведите курсор на номер строки слева (например, на цифру 5).
- Нажмите правую кнопку мыши.
- В меню выберите пункт «Вставить». Результат: Пустая строка появится над пятой, а бывшая пятая станет шестой.
Чтобы вставить сразу несколько строк, выделите мышью такое же количество существующих строк (зажав левую кнопку и протянув по номерам). Команда «Вставить» создаст ровно столько же пустых строк.
Способ 2: Горячие клавиши (для скорости)
Если руки находятся на клавиатуре, этот способ экономит до 80% времени:
- Выделите любую ячейку в строке, над которой нужно сделать вставку (или всю строку через
Shift + Пробел). - Нажмите Ctrl + Shift + «+» (знак плюс).
Примечание: На ноутбуках без отдельного блока цифр может потребоваться зажать
Fnили использовать знак+на основной клавиатуре.
Способ 3: Через ленту меню
Используйте этот вариант, если предпочитаете визуальный интерфейс:
- Выделите строку.
- Перейдите на вкладку «Главная».
- В группе «Ячейки» нажмите кнопку «Вставить» и выберите «Вставить строки листа».
Добавление столбцов в таблицу
Логика работы со столбцами аналогична строкам, но направление сдвига меняется: данные перемещаются вправо, а новый столбец появляется слева от выделенного.
Алгоритм действий
- Кликните левой кнопкой мыши по букве столбца в верхней части листа (A, B, C...).
- Нажмите правую кнопку мыши → «Вставить».
Или используйте горячие клавиши: Выделите столбец (
Ctrl + Пробел) и нажмите Ctrl + Shift + «+».
Будьте внимательны при вставке столбцов внутри формул. Если ваша формула ссылается на диапазон, который расширяется из-за вставки, результат пересчитается корректно. Однако, если формула жестко зафиксирована, проверьте ссылки после изменения структуры.
Точечная вставка отдельных ячеек
Иногда не требуется добавлять целую строку или столбец — нужно лишь раздвинуть конкретные ячейки, чтобы освободить место для нового значения.
Пошаговая инструкция
- Выделите одну или несколько ячеек, куда планируется вставка.
- Нажмите правую кнопку мыши и выберите «Вставить...» (не просто «Вставить», а пункт с троеточием или через меню ленты).
- В открывшемся диалоговом окне выберите направление сдвига:
- Со сдвигом вправо: существующие данные в строке пойдут вправо.
- Со сдвигом вниз: данные в столбце опустятся ниже.
- Ячейки целиком: доступно только при вставке скопированных ячеек.
- Строку/Столбец целиком: переключает режим на вставку целой линии.
Этот метод полезен, когда нужно исправить ошибку в середине заполненного диапазона, не нарушая общую структуру таблицы.
Работа с «Умными таблицами» и особые случаи
Современные версии Excel (2016–365) часто используют форматированные «Умные таблицы» (создаются через Ctrl + T). Они ведут себя иначе, чем обычные диапазоны.
Автоматическое расширение умных таблиц
Если вы вводите данные в ячейку, непосредственно примыкающую к умной таблице (снизу или справа), таблица автоматически расширяется, включая новые данные. Отдельная вставка строк часто не требуется — просто начните печатать.
Вставка в защищенный лист
Если при попытке вставки вы получаете ошибку о защите, значит, лист заблокирован автором.
- Перейдите на вкладку «Рецензирование».
- Нажмите «Снять защиту листа».
- Введите пароль (если он известен).
- Выполните вставку строк или столбцов.
- Верните защиту обратно для безопасности данных.
При работе с большими объемами данных (тысячи строк) вставка может временно «подвесить» интерфейс. Это нормально. Дождитесь завершения пересчета формул перед дальнейшей работой.
Сравнение методов вставки
| Задача | Лучший метод | Время выполнения | Примечание |
|---|---|---|---|
| Вставить 1 строку/столбец | Горячие клавиши (Ctrl+Shift++) | < 1 сек | Требует запоминания комбинации |
| Вставить 5+ строк сразу | Выделение + Правая кнопка мыши | 3-5 сек | Удобно визуально контролировать количество |
| Сдвинуть часть ячеек | Меню «Вставить...» -> Выбор сдвига | 5-7 сек | Единственный способ точечного сдвига |
| Работа в умной таблице | Ввод данных в соседнюю ячейку | Мгновенно | Автоматическое расширение формата |
Частые ошибки и их решение
- Кнопка «Вставить» неактивна (серая).
- Причина: Вы редактируете содержимое другой ячейки (курсор мигает внутри клетки).
- Решение: Нажмите
EnterилиEsc, чтобы выйти из режима редактирования, затем повторите действие.
- Вместо вставки данные заменились.
- Причина: Вы скопировали данные (
Ctrl+C) и вставили их (Ctrl+V) поверх существующих, вместо использования команды добавления строк. - Решение: Используйте именно команду «Вставить строки листа», а не обычную вставку буфера обмена.
- Причина: Вы скопировали данные (
- Формулы показывают ошибку #ССЫЛКА! (#REF!).
- Причина: Вы удалили строку/столбец, на которые ссылались формулы, либо вставили данные некорректно в сложную структуру.
- Решение: Отмените действие (
Ctrl+Z) и проверьте логику ссылок перед повторной вставкой.
- Нарушено форматирование.
- Причина: Вставленная строка не унаследовала стиль таблицы.
- Решение: Используйте инструмент «Формат по образцу» или убедитесь, что вставка происходит внутри диапазона умной таблицы.
FAQ
Можно ли вставить строку в самом низу таблицы? Да, но проще просто начать вводить данные в первую пустую строку под таблицей. Если таблица обычная — она расширится. Если умная — она подхватит формат автоматически.
Как вставить строку между двумя другими быстро?
Выделите нижнюю из двух строк (между которыми нужна вставка) и нажмите Ctrl + Shift + +. Новая строка появится ровно посередине.
Что делать, если нужно вставить строку, но сохранить данные исходной строки?
Сначала скопируйте исходную строку (Ctrl+C), затем вставьте пустую строку над ней (Ctrl+Shift++), а после этого вставьте скопированные данные в нужное место.
Работают ли эти способы в Excel для Mac?
Да, логика идентична. Единственное отличие — вместо клавиши Ctrl используется клавиша Command (⌘). Комбинация для вставки: Cmd + Shift + +.